air B & B a flip house?

I am trying to sell my latest flip house.  We unfortunately finished it right when the interest rates went up this fall and everything slowed down around here. I'm confident that the house will sell but it's taking a little time. I am wondering if it's a good idea to air B&B it while I'm waiting to help cover the carrying costs. Has anyone done this and has it been worth it?

From my experience owning AirBnbs, I'm not sure it fits as a solution to covering carrying costs unless you're planning on selling it as a turnkey AirBnb. You will need to furnish, list and get reviews before any significant revenue comes in. Of course, if you're planning on holding it long-term that's a different story. Make sure to check for permits etc in your area.
